Skip to content

Instantly share code, notes, and snippets.

@uncoded-ro
Created January 12, 2020 12:36
Show Gist options
  • Save uncoded-ro/f125c5f658cdb82902f2cc4c94943bff to your computer and use it in GitHub Desktop.
Save uncoded-ro/f125c5f658cdb82902f2cc4c94943bff to your computer and use it in GitHub Desktop.
package ro.virtualcampus.person;
import java.io.IOException;
import ro.virtualcampus.unit.Facultate;
public class Student extends Persoana {
private Facultate facultate;
private int anStudiu;
public Student(String nume, int varsta, Facultate facultate, int anStudiu) {
super(nume, varsta);
this.facultate = facultate;
this.anStudiu = anStudiu;
}
public Student(String obj) throws IOException {
super(obj);
facultate = new Facultate(null, null);
System.out.print("nume facultate: ");
this.facultate.setNume(in.readLine());
System.out.print("adresa facultate: ");
this.facultate.setAdresa(in.readLine());
System.out.print("an studiu: ");
this.anStudiu = Integer.parseInt(in.readLine());
}
public Facultate getFacultate() {
return facultate;
}
public void setFacultate(Facultate facultate) {
this.facultate = facultate;
}
public int getAnStudiu() {
return anStudiu;
}
public void setAnStudiu(int anStudiu) {
this.anStudiu = anStudiu;
}
@Override
public String toString() {
return "Student [facultate=" + facultate + ", anStudiu=" + anStudiu
+ ", nume=" + nume + ", varsta=" + varsta + "]";
}
}
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ment